One cup of Yuzu kosho sauce is around 235.8 grams and contains approximately 157.2 calories, 0 grams of protein, 0 grams of fat, and 31.4 grams of carbohydrates.
Yuzu Kosho Sauce is a vibrant Japanese condiment made from the zesty yuzu citrus fruit, fiery green or red chili peppers, and a pinch of salt. Originating from Kyushu, this sauce embodies the essence of Japanese cuisine, adding a bold, tangy kick to dishes. Packed with antioxidants from the yuzu and offering a low-calorie alternative to heavier sauces, it's perfect for those seeking a flavorful yet healthy option.
